Pierce elected to Executive CouncilPosted Feb 5, 2014 |
|
[Episcopal Church Office of Public Affairs press release] The Rev. Nathaniel W. Pierce of the Diocese of Easton has been elected the Province III clergy representative on the Episcopal Church Executive Council.
The announcement was made by the Rev. Canon Michael Barlowe, Executive Officer of General Convention, during the opening session of the Executive Council meeting on February 5 at the Conference Center at the Maritime Institute in Linthicum Heights, MD (Diocese of Maryland).
The vacancy on Executive Council was created by the resignation of the Rev. Chris Cunningham.
Pierce was elected by the board of Province III. Pierce’s term begins immediately and continues until a Province III board member is elected in 2015.
Pierce currently serves as Worship Leader of St. Philip’s Episcopal Church, Quantico, MD, Diocese of Easton.
